75-0: The Documentary

2013 45 min

This is a story about winning and losing in youth sports and the lasting effects it had on a group of players who played on one of the worst high school football teams in New Jersey history. Centering around one game that this team lost 75-0 we learn about their pain and agony they still feel even after 46 years! Through interviews with ex-players, experts on sports psychology, and game footage we explore the reasons how losing became a habit and more importantly how they transformed it into one of life's great lessons .
